[16p-E402-8] Spontaneous Orientation of Polar Phytochemicals

Kouki Akaike1, Takuya Hosokai1, Yutaro Ono2, Ryohei Tsuruta2, Yoichi Yamada2 (1.AIST, 2.Univ. Tsukuba)

Keywords:caffeic acid, work function, organic devices

In this study, we applied caffeic acid (CfA) to an electrode modifier for organic devices with superior sustainability. It was found that the adsorption of CfA increased electrodes' work function by ~0.5 eV, independent of their types. Since the catechol group in CfA preferentially interacts with metal surfaces, the dipole layer is formed at the electrode interfaces, leading to the work function increase. We will also report the giant surface potential by a polar phytochemical in the presentation.
